A few days ago, we shared the unfortunate news that Ginuwine might be heading for bankruptcy, and that he and his wife Solé are on the verge of divorcing. Now the 'Pony' creator is speaking out and trying to clear up a few rumors.

In an Instagram post -- that has since been removed -- the '90's R&B star said his wife is a wonderful woman and it's not her fault that he's in the predicament he's in. He also said their divorce hasn't been finalized yet.

"We are not yet divorced, but we are currently separated and working towards coming to our own agreement, without lawyers, to amicably and fairly divorce," Ginuwine wrote. "Reports that she left me broke are untrue. She has been a good wife and mother and my poor choices and actions over many years have lead to this. I am on a path of becoming a better man, and part of that is taking responsibility for my own choices and behavior in life."

Reportedly, the 44-year-old father of five owes a lot of money to his lawyer, Bruce Beckner, and $250,000 to his former executive producer, Robert Reives, who he's now battling in court. He also owes the U.S. government over $300,000 in taxes, so clearly he's dealing with a few problems.

But by the looks of his recent Instagram posts, Ginuwine is doing a lot of self-improvement like working out, strengthening his spiritual side and reading. Maybe those moves will have him coming out of this negative path a better and stronger person.
